Bodyshell is rated as unstable and not capable of withstanding further stress, this does not inspire confidence, for reference, the latest generation Maruti Suzuki Alto has the bodyshell rated as stable when it scored 2 stars in the latest GNCAP test, as much as I appreciate Hyundai Verna scoring 5 stars, I feel further strengthening of bodyshell should be considered.

I don't know if you know this, but the made in India VW Virtus and Skoda Slavia are also 5 star rated cars as per GNCAP.

Virtus and by extension Slavia, have a marginally better overall Adult safety rating than Verna and identical rating for Child protection. But, the most important thing is that their bodyshell has been rated as "Stable".
